  • Abstract
    The design and implementation of a 28 GHz radio distribution point demonstrator system are described. The unit was fed remotely by 10 km of optical fiber, using the subcarrier multiplexing technique. It carried both analog FM video and 8 Mb/s duplex data to demonstrate the flexible delivery of a mix of services. Some practical aspects and limitations of the system, which has operated continuously within specification since April 1991, are outlined. Potential area for future improvement are identified
